F, G, and H are not interchangeable because of the conditions imposed by the question stem.
Let's run through the set-up quickly.
We know that six textbooks will each be evaluated over six weeks. There are three I textbooks - F, G, and H - and three A textbooks - X, Y, and Z.
Each textbook will be evaluated once by J and once by R.
J: _ _ _ _ _ _ R: _ _ _ _ _ _ 1 2 3 4 5 6
Rule 1 - R cannot evaluate any I textbook until J has evaluated that textbook
Therefore, R cannot evaluate any I textbook during Week 1 and J cannot evaluate any I textbook during Week 6.
Rule 2 - J cannot evaluate any A textbook until R has evaluated that textbook.
Therefore, J cannot evaluate any A textbook during Week 1 and R cannot evaluate any A textbook during Week 6.
Rule 3 - R cannot evaluate any two I textbooks consecutively
Rule 4 - J must evaluate X during Week 4
The question stem also tells us that J evaluates H during Week 3 and R evaluates G during Week 6.
What do we know so far?
J: _ _ H X _ _ R: _ _ _ _ _ G 1 2 3 4 5 6
Rule 1 tells us that R cannot evaluate any I textbook until J has evaluated that textbook. Therefore, R must evaluate H after Week 3.
Rule 3 tells us that R cannot evaluate any two I textbooks consecutively. This means that R cannot evaluate H during Week 5. Therefore, R must evaluate H during Week 4 and R must evaluate A textbooks during Weeks 3 and 5.
J: _ _ H X _ _ R: _ _ A H A G 1 2 3 4 5 6
This severely restricts the placement of F. R cannot evaluate F until after J has evaluated it. As there are only two weeks left open on R's schedule and we deduced above that R cannot evaluate any I textbook during Week 1, R must evaluate F during Week 2. This means that J must evaluate F during Week 1.
